Role Overview

To work as part of a team providing effective 24-hour support to young people aged 16 to 25 who are experiencing homelessness or are at risk of homelessness, often as a result of leaving care, family breakdown or relationship difficulties. The post holder will provide a safe, supportive and caring environment, helping young people to build confidence, develop independent living skills, and work towards achieving positive outcomes and sustainable independent living.
